Material Flow Analysis of Nutrient in Haman Agricultural Area
Abstract
The environmental problem of the agro-ecosystem has increased due to excessive input of fertilizer and nutritious material. Therefore, managing the agricultural land by location based system management is required.
In this study, material flow analysis(MFA) of nutrients in Haman agricultural area for past 15 years (1995∼2010) has been done.
As a result, the average amount of excessive nitrogen in Haman agricultural land was 1,197.08 Ton/year which showed decreasing pattern of 1,589.77 Ton/year in 1995 and 652.27 Ton/year in 2010. In case of phosphorus, the average amount was 637.17 Ton/year which also showed the decreasing patter of 725.56 Ton/year in 1995 and 653.48 Ton by 2010. These decreasing patterns were due to changes in agricultural policies.
Even with the decreased amount of excessive amount, there still are a massive amount of excessive nutrient.
Excessive nutrient remaining on the agricultural land can accumulate and cause soil pollution or flow out as runoff by precipitation and cause water pollution. Therefore management plan to reduce the excessive use of fertilizer is required.
